Who created Deep Blue?

In 1997, IBM’s Deep Blue computer became the first machine to defeat a reigning world chess champion in a match under standard tournament conditions. The computer’s victory over Garry Kasparov was seen as a landmark achievement in the field of artificial intelligence. But who created Deep Blue, and how did it manage to achieve such a remarkable feat?

Deep Blue was the result of more than two decades of research by IBM. In the early 1980s, IBM researchers began work on a project called Deep Thought, which was designed to create a computer that could beat a human at chess. In 1989, Deep Thought was upgraded to become Deep Blue, and the machine was put to the task of defeating Kasparov.

Deep Blue was powered by a custom-built chip called a Systolic Array. This chip was designed to brute-force its way through possible chess moves, calculating as many as 200 million moves per second. In order to make the most of this processing power, Deep Blue used a technique called alpha-beta pruning. This technique eliminated moves that were unlikely to lead to a win, allowing the computer to focus on the most promising options.

In addition to its powerful hardware, Deep Blue was also equipped with a sophisticated chess-playing algorithm. This algorithm was designed to evaluate each chess position and determine the most likely path to victory.

Why is the computer so good at chess?

The computer is able to beat the best chess players in the world because it can calculate a large number of moves very quickly. It can also weigh up the pros and cons of each move very accurately.
